Geomatikk Wins Nationwide Contract for Cable Location
Trafikverket in Sweden has signed a strategic multi-year contract with Geomatikk for delivery of a national and unified service for cable location and coordinate measurement within Sweden’s entire railway network. The procurement represents an important step in Trafikverket’s work to streamline and quality-assure the management of the extensive electrical, signaling, and telecommunications infrastructure.
Critical Infrastructure Requires Specialist Expertise

Trafikverket is responsible for a technically advanced and nationwide infrastructure where cables and technical equipment are placed in or adjacent to railway embankments as well as in public land. The assignment places high demands on technical competence and safety when working near railway facilities.

Reduce Disruptions

The purpose of the procurement is to create a common and nationwide service for cable location for all lines within the railway system. Trafikverket also aims to achieve a better documented network and reduce disruptions in the track environment.

Effective cable location is a central part of Trafikverket’s strategy to reduce the risk of cable damage and their consequences: 

  • Train delays 
  • Disruptions in Trafikverket’s internal network for data and telecommunications
  • Disruptions in deliveries of data and telecommunications to external customers
